Leonardo DiCaprio’s girlfriend is definitely not a fan of the ‘lollipop look’. His Israeli supermodel flame Bar Raefeli says she can’t stand women looking unhealthy, and would always encourage them to eat more.
While this seems an easy thing to spout when you’re in possession of a perfectly curvy yet toned body, Bar does have a point. "I get so sad when I see 15-year-old pale extremely skinny models at the agency looking all shaky and hungry. when will it end?!?!?” she writes on her Twitter page.
Bar also lashes out at women who have plastic surgery. "Seriously, plastic surgery is not helping your impact on young women or your looks," she says.
And despite being voted one of the world's most desirable women recently Bar (25) says she feels sexiest when she’s dressed down. "It's a lot about how you move in your outfit and if you feel comfortable in it,” she says. "I like comfortable clothes - long dresses, jeans, shorts. I like it simple and prefer not having to accessorise a lot."
